Xcel Energy agreed to cut its proposed electricity rate increase for North Dakota customers. The agreement raises overall rates by 10.37%, with the increase for residential customers at 12.92%.
Abdirahman Hassan Yusuf, a Somalian refugee admitted to the U.S. in 1998, was arrested on his way to work on Wednesday. Attorneys have filed an emergency petition for his release.
